ConnDOT Sets Public Hearing On Proposed Fare Hikes
The department is looking to increase Metro-North ticket prices by more than 16%
Have an opinion on the fare increase ? You'll have a chance to share it with state officials later this month.
On Tuesday, the Connecticut Department of Transportation announced a series of public hearings on fare hikes planned for rail and bus systems across the state.
Locally, hearings are set for Tuesday, Aug. 23 at UConn Stamford's General Re Auditorium (1 University Pl.). Two sessions are scheduled, one from 4:00 to 6:00 p.m. and a second from 7:00 to 9:00 p.m. A full calendar can be found below.

The possibility of fare increases in a balanced budget proposal put forward by Gov. Dannel Malloy. That plan called for a 15 percent rise in Metro-North fares on the New Haven line.
ConnDOT now puts the proposed hike at about 16.4 percent, followed by an additional 1 percent increase each Jan. 1 through 2018. The initial hike would take place on or after Nov. 1 of this year.

Shore Line East, which faces a similar fare increase, would see its weekend service eliminated under the plan.
ConnDOT has yet to publish complete fare tables for the proposed rail hikes. Neither set of fares has been raised since 2005.
This month's hearings will also address possible service cuts and a 10 percent fare hike proposed for local bus systems across the state, including those serving the Stamford area.
Under ConnDOT's plan, base fare would go from $1.25 to $1.35, senior and disabled fare would increase from $.60 to $.65, and ADA paratransit fare would rise from $2.50 to $2.70.
